Trong bài đăng này, chúng ta sẽ xem cách tạo điện thoại trong iOS theo chương trình.
Vì vậy, hãy bắt đầu.
Bước 1 - Mở Xcode → Dự án mới → Ứng dụng một lần xem → Đặt tên là “MakeCall”
Bước 2 - Mở Main.storyboard và thêm một trường văn bản và một nút như hình dưới đây
Bước 3 - Tạo @IBOutlet cho trường văn bản, đặt tên là phoneNumberTextfield.
Bước 4 - Tạo @IBAction method callButtonClicked for call button
Bước 5 - Để thực hiện cuộc gọi, chúng ta có thể sử dụng iOS openURL. Trong callButtonClicked, hãy thêm các dòng sau
if let url = URL(string: "tel://\(phoneNumberTextfield.text!)"), UIApplication.shared.canOpenURL(url) { UIApplication.shared.open(url, options: [:], completionHandler: nil)
Bước 6 - Chạy ứng dụng và nhập số bạn muốn gọi đến như hình bên dưới
Bước 7 - Nhấp vào nút gọi, bạn sẽ được hiển thị cảnh báo với các tùy chọn ‘Gọi’ và ‘Hủy’
Bước 8 - Bấm vào nút gọi, cuộc gọi sẽ được thực hiện đến số, như hình dưới đây